Right-click on the Desktop and select Properties. Click the Screen Saver tab and in the drop-down select (None). Now, click the Power button. Ensure you choose not to have the hard disk turned off, and there should be an option to "do nothing" when the lid is closed. You may want to extend the "sleep" mode timeout as well as turning off "hibernate"

I had the same problem with poor mileage after I had the T-Max installed at Sturgis. Even after putting on over 2K miles. T-Max support requested that I download/install the latest version of the SmartLinkIV software. Under the Help menu, it as a "Prepare and send, Module data email". This will send all the module settings and offsets to Zippers support. I was getting 36-38mpg and a lot pinging. Support got back to me and requested I load a different base map and reset the learned offsets. Since I have been getting 45-48 and the bike runs much better.
